Group 1 - The president of the American Soybean Association, Caleb Lagrange, expressed that U.S. soybean farmers are facing significant financial pressure due to ongoing trade disputes with China, urging President Trump to prioritize soybean issues in trade negotiations [2] - The Federal Reserve decided to maintain the federal funds rate target range at 4.25%-4.5%, citing economic uncertainty and a slowdown in economic activity during the first half of the year [3] - The People's Bank of China announced that the Loan Prime Rate (LPR) remained unchanged for three consecutive months, with the one-year LPR at 3.0% and the five-year LPR at 3.5%, aligning with market expectations [4] Group 2 - The State Council of China issued guidelines for the construction and operation of government and social capital cooperation projects, emphasizing the prioritization of projects with certain returns [5] - The Ministry of Finance and the State Taxation Administration announced that childcare subsidies will be exempt from personal income tax starting January 1, 2025, establishing a mechanism for information sharing among relevant departments [5] - The China Securities Regulatory Commission reported that there are currently 131 listed commodity futures and options in China, with 84 being industrial products, which account for 64% of the total [7] Group 3 - Several small and medium-sized banks in China have announced reductions in deposit rates by 10 to 20 basis points, in response to ongoing pressure on net interest margins [8] - In June, the domestic smartphone market saw a shipment of 22.598 million units, a year-on-year decline of 9.3%, with 5G smartphones accounting for 81.6% of total shipments [9] - The Guangzhou Baiyun International Airport has expanded its "one-minute boarding" service to flights from Guangzhou to Shanghai, allowing passengers without checked luggage to board shortly before departure [10] Group 4 - The Guangxi region in China has launched a free HPV vaccination program for eligible girls, aiming to provide vaccinations to approximately 960,000 girls over three years [11] - The Hong Kong Stock Exchange is considering a 24-hour trading mechanism, following the example of Nasdaq, with plans to study the feasibility based on local market conditions [12][13] - The UK inflation rate rose to 3.8% in July, the highest level in 19 months, exceeding the Bank of England's target of 2% [15]

Market Overview - On August 20, the A-share market saw a rebound with the Shanghai Composite Index, Shenzhen Component Index, and ChiNext Index all reaching new highs for the year. The Shanghai and Shenzhen markets had a total trading volume of 2.41 trillion yuan, a decrease of 180.1 billion yuan from the previous trading day, marking six consecutive days of over 2 trillion yuan in trading volume. Over 3,600 stocks rose in the market [2][3] - The Shanghai Composite Index increased by 1.04% to 3766.21 points, the Shenzhen Component Index rose by 0.89% to 11926.74 points, and the ChiNext Index gained 0.23% to 2607.65 points [3] Sector Performance - Chip stocks surged in the afternoon, while consumer stocks such as liquor rebounded. Consumer electronics also showed active performance. Conversely, high-priced stocks collectively fell, with sectors like film, chemical pharmaceuticals, CRO, and vitamins experiencing declines. The top-performing sectors included liquor, semiconductors, AI glasses, and minor metals, while the worst-performing sectors were film, chemical pharmaceuticals, CRO, and vitamins [2] International Market - In the U.S. stock market on August 20, the Dow Jones Industrial Average rose by 16.04 points (0.04%) to 44938.31 points, while the S&P 500 fell by 15.59 points (0.24%) to 6395.78 points, and the Nasdaq Composite dropped by 142.09 points (0.67%) to 21172.86 points [4][6] - In Europe, the FTSE 100 index increased by 98.92 points (1.08%) to 9288.14 points, while the CAC 40 index in France fell by 6.05 points (0.08%) to 7973.03 points, and the DAX index in Germany decreased by 146.10 points (0.60%) to 24276.97 points [4] Commodity Prices - International oil prices rose on August 20, with light crude oil futures for September delivery increasing by $0.86 (1.38%) to $63.21 per barrel, and Brent crude oil futures for October delivery rising by $1.05 (1.60%) to $66.84 per barrel [5] Automotive Market - According to the China Passenger Car Association, from August 1 to 17, the national retail sales of passenger cars reached 866,000 units, a year-on-year increase of 2%. Cumulatively, retail sales for the year reached 13.611 million units, up 10% year-on-year. The retail sales of new energy vehicles during the same period were 502,000 units, a year-on-year increase of 9% [11] Financial Regulations - The National Financial Regulatory Administration has proposed that the proportion of controlling mergers and acquisitions loans should not exceed 70% of the transaction price, while equity funds must account for at least 30%. This aims to mitigate high-leverage merger financing risks [8] Company Announcements - Muyuan Foods reported a net profit growth of 1170% year-on-year for the first half of the year, while Weicai Technology saw a net profit increase of 831% year-on-year. Tianwei Foods is planning to issue H-shares and list on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ange [14]
